Literature summary extracted from

  • Koncz, C.; Kiss, A.; Venetianer, P.
    Biochemical characterization of the restriction-modification system of Bacillus sphaericus (1978), Eur. J. Biochem., 89, 523-529.
    View publication on PubMed

General Stability

EC Number General Stability Organism
3.1.21.4 in dilute solutions at 37°C, 50% inactivation after 30 min Lysinibacillus sphaericus
3.1.21.4 inactivation by lyophilization Lysinibacillus sphaericus

Inhibitors

EC Number Inhibitors Comment Organism Structure
3.1.21.4 high ionic strength irreversible inactivation Lysinibacillus sphaericus
3.1.21.4 Zn2+ 2 mM, complete inhibition Lysinibacillus sphaericus

Metals/Ions

EC Number Metals/Ions Comment Organism Structure
3.1.21.4 Mg2+ required Lysinibacillus sphaericus
3.1.21.4 Mn2+ can partially replace Mg2+, optimal concentration is 10 mM Lysinibacillus sphaericus

Storage Stability

EC Number Storage Stability Organism
3.1.21.4 -20°C, 50% glycerol, 8-12 months no appreciable loss of activity Lysinibacillus sphaericus

Substrates and Products (Substrate)

EC Number Substrates Comment Substrates Organism Products Comment (Products) Rev. Reac.
3.1.21.4 DNA + H2O single strandede DNA and double stranded DNA Lysinibacillus sphaericus double-stranded DNA fragments with terminal 5'-phosphates
-
?

Subunits

EC Number Subunits Comment Organism
3.1.21.4 monomer 1 * 35000, SDS-PAGE Lysinibacillus sphaericus
